High Melting Point Oval Type Crucible Metal Melting Silicon Carbide Graphite Isostatic Pressing Technology
Oval-shaped SiC graphite crucibles are crafted from a blend of silicon carbide and graphite, which provides them with exceptional heat resistance and structural integrity. These crucibles are particularly useful in applications where an even distribution of heat and a controlled pouring process are required.
Oval type crucible suitable for automated operations with robotic arms. A partition is added in the middle of the crucible, enabling simultaneous melting and working.
Oval Type Crucible, also known as an oval-shaped ceramic crucible, is meticulously crafted to cater to high-temperature applications that necessitate an elongated vessel for the melting or heating processes of specific materials. These crucibles are particularly designed to optimize the heating efficiency and accommodate the shape and volume of materials being processed.
Oval Type Crucibles are widely utilized in a variety of industrial and laboratory settings due to their unique design and material properties that cater to specific high-temperature processes.
Melting Metals: Oval Type Crucibles are used in foundries and metalworking industries for the melting of metals. Their elongated shape allows for efficient heat distribution and controlled pouring, which is particularly useful for metals that require a steady and directed flow during the pouring process.
